Seamless Indoor-Outdoor Flow

Once walled off from homes, yards have become extended living areas through expanded windows, sprawling patios, and retractable walls. These blurred lines between interior and exterior spaces reflect our lifestyles built around alfresco living.

Install floor-to-ceiling glass walls that fully retract, essentially erasing barriers between inside and outside. Construct large, covered patios for lounging and dining just steps from living areas. With Wi-Fi extending outdoors, designate lounge nooks for remote work with power outlets. Illuminate patios and walkways for evening enjoyment with thoughtfully placed lighting. This seamlessness promotes an active, healthy lifestyle.

Multifunctional Rooms

Rethinking room roles allows homes to better suit modern living patterns. Why confine spaces to single functions when flexible rooms accommodate work, exercise, and hobbies?

Transform formal living rooms into home offices or yoga studios. Use modular furniture like sofas that transition into beds and convert unused dining rooms to craft areas or music salons. Install flooring suitable for diverse activities.

Multipurpose rooms ensure homes evolve with needs. Built-in and concealed storage like disappearing wall beds and hidden shelving units keep items tidy but easily accessible. Durable, cleanable surfaces like tile withstand diverse uses. Technology such as wall-mounted TVs and speakers enhances flexibility.

Spa-Inspired Bathrooms

Once purely utilitarian, today’s bathrooms provide serene escape from stress through spa-like amenities. From showers simulating rainstorms to aromatherapy-infused soaking tubs, master baths provide wellness.

Install frameless glass-enclosed showers with adjustable body sprays, steam, lights, and sound. Select wall-mount faucets and hardware in a European style. Radiant heated floors, towel warmers and waterproof speakers relax. 

Built-In Smart Home Technology

Technology once tacked on as an afterthought now takes center stage, built right into home systems for efficiency and simplicity. Focus on discreetly integrating tech for lighting, temperature, security, audio and more.

Let motion sensors activate lights in closets and pantries when opened and use voice controls or apps to adjust thermostats and music. Conceal audiovisual equipment and charging stations into walls and cabinetry. Select intelligent kitchen appliances and plumbing fixtures. With everything automated and at your fingertips, houses run smoother.

Creative Outdoor Retreats

Backyards transform into open-air escapes through imaginative amenities like sprawling patios, outdoor kitchens, firepit lounges, and backyard theaters. Embrace outdoor venues for work and play.

Construct a pergola draped in string lights over a stone fireplace and seating for evening cocktails. Build a covered pavilion for alfresco dining or convert a shed into a backyard office. Install an outdoor projector and screen to watch movies at night.

Make spaces multi-seasonal with heating, fans, covers and waterproof furniture/rugs. The personalized outdoor oasis extends living space.

Unexpected Materials and Finishes 

Tired of the expected, designers embrace industrial metals, weathered woods, concrete and other raw materials that add an unexpected twist. The unique materials add artful interest through color, texture, and imperfection.

Accent walls with riveted metal panels or rustic wood reclaimed from old barns. Use concrete on floors, walls, and countertops for an urban edge. Whitewash brick interior walls to contrast with their roughness. Display galvanized metal buckets and glassware. The creative combinations feel special.
